3 custom
A n1 ( personal habit) coutume f, habitude f ; it is/was her custom to do elle a/avait l'habitude de faire ; as is/was his custom selon sa coutume ;2 ( convention) coutume f, usage m ; it is/was the custom to do il est/était d'usage de faire ; custom requires that l'usage veut que (+ subj) ;3 Comm ( patronage) clientèle f ; they've lost a lot of custom ils ont perdu beaucoup de clients ; I shall take my custom elsewhere j'irai me faire servir ailleurs ;4 Jur coutume f. -
